Kilowatt per meter per kelvin to Kilocalorie it per hour per meter per celcius Conversion Formula:

kilocalorie (IT)/hour/meter/°C = kilowatt/meter/K (kW/(m*K)) × 859.845228

How to Convert kilowatt/meter/K (kW/(m*K)) to kilocalorie (IT)/hour/meter/°C?

To get Kilocalorie it per hour per meter per celcius thermal conductivity, simply multiply Kilowatt per meter per kelvin by 859.845228. Kilowatt per meter per kelvin Definition

A kilowatt per meter per K (kW·m⁻¹·K⁻¹) is a decimal multiple of the derived SI unit of thermal conductivity watt per meter per K. 1 W·m⁻¹·K⁻¹ shows that in a material one joule of energy per one second (that is one watt) moves through the distance of one meter due to a temperature difference of one kelvin.

Kilocalorie it per hour per meter per celcius Definition

An international kilocalorie per hour per meter per degree Celsius (kcal(IT) ·h⁻¹·m⁻¹·°С⁻¹) is a decimal unit of thermal conductivity. 1 kcal(IT) ·h⁻¹·m⁻¹·°С⁻¹ shows that in a material one international kilocalorie of energy per one hour moves through the distance of one meter due to a temperature difference of one degree Celsius.
